Hi. I’m Pam Lindemann, the founder of The IEP Advocate and your instructor.
I’ve been advocating for children’s special education rights for the past 27 years. First, for my own daughter who was born with cerebral palsy. Then, for other kids who needed my help.
In 2003, I became the voice of parents at the state level, joining a state policy board for early intervention and education.
In 2009, I founded The IEP Advocate, the first ever organization of IEP advocates in Florida.
During my career as an IEP advocate, I have personally attended well over 3,000 IEP meetings and conducted several hundreds of webinars and trainings to help parents and caregivers understand how much influence you have over the education of your children.
